What does a retail banking manager do?
Career: Retail Banking Manager
A Retail Banking Manager oversees the daily operations of a bank branch or multiple branches, ensuring excellent customer service, effective sales of banking products, and compliance with regulations. They are responsible for leading and training staff, managing budgets, and achieving sales targets. Retail Banking Managers also handle customer inquiries and resolve issues, working to improve the overall banking experience for clients. Their role is crucial in fostering client relationships and driving the branch's financial success.
